Homemade Waffle Mix

Created by: Howcan Team

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 3/4 cups milk
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  • In a large bowl, whisk together 2 cups of all-purpose flour, 1/4 cup of granulated sugar, 1 tablespoon of baking powder,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together 1 3/4 cups of milk, 1/2 cup of vegetable oil, 2 large eggs, and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ract.
  •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Do not overmix; it's okay if there are a few lumps.
  • Preheat your waffle iron according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• Pour the appropriate amount of batter onto the preheated waffle iron and cook according to the manufacturer's instructions, usually for about 3-5 minutes or until golden brown and crispy.
  • Serve the waffles immediately with your favorite toppings and enjoy!

Waffle mix has a rich history dating back to the Middle Ages when bakers cooked batter between two metal plates. In the 18th century, Thomas Jefferson brought a waffle iron from France to the United States, popularizing the dish. Today, waffle mix is a beloved breakfast staple, with variations found in different regions. Chefs and home cooks alike have perfected the art of creating light, fluffy waffles using a mix of flour, eggs, milk, and leavening agents. Some renowned restaurants, like the Waffle House chain in the US, have elevated the humble waffle to an art form. For the best waffle mix, ensuring the right balance of ingredients is crucial, and some swear by adding a touch of vanilla or cinnamon for extra flavor. Whether enjoyed with syrup, fruit, or whipped cream, waffle mix continues to delight taste buds worldwide.
